This print showcases the awe-inspiring "Christ's Descent into Hell". Russian icon, created by the talented artists of the Novgorod School in the late 14th century. Measuring an impressive 134x108 cm, this tempera on panel masterpiece is housed in the prestigious State Russian Museum in St. Petersburg, Russia. The painting depicts a profound moment from Christian theology, as Christ descends into hell after his crucifixion to free the souls of those who had passed away before his resurrection. The composition is rich with symbolism and religious significance, beautifully rendered with intricate details and vibrant colors. Despite its age, this iconic artwork has stood the test of time and remains a testament to both artistic skill and spiritual devotion. The damage that can be seen adds character to this ancient piece while reminding us of its journey through history.
